Discover Impactful Work:
Associate S cientist will conduct the cell culture lab works in both cell line development (CLD) and cell culture process development (Upstream) teams to support the development of stable manufacture cell lines that express the therapeutic antibodies.

Essential Functions of the Job (Key responsibilities)
  • Completes experiments for generating stable CHO cell lines expressing therapeutic antibodies, which include preparation DNA for transfection, conduct experiment in transfection, screening of transfected cells, as well as routine cell culture work.

  • Prepare media, buffers and solutions needed for laboratory work.

  • Write routine electronic laboratory notebook (ELN).

  • Present work summary to internal function teams.

  • Communicates clearly and collaborate actively with internal cross-functional teams to facilitate pipeline development of large molecules.

  • Other responsibilities as assigned

Qualifications (Minimal acceptable level of education, work experience, and competency)
  • BS degree within chemical engineering, biochemical engineering biology, molecular biology, biochemistry or cell biology and 1+ years of experience in an appropriate subject area or working towards relevant qualification

  • Basic knowledge in aseptic cell culture is required, hands-on experience in cell culture process development is helpful, relevant experience is a plus.

  • Good verbal and written communication skills.

  • Collaborative, organized, and pay attention to details.
